#18036f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#18036f is composed of 9.4% red, 1.2% green and 43.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.4% cyan, 97.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 56.5% black. It has a hue angle of 251.7 degrees, a saturation of 94.7% and a lightness of 22.4%. #18036f color hex could be obtained by blending #3006de with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

Shades and Tints of #18036f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030010 is the darkest color, while #fcfbff is the lightest one.

Tones of #18036f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#38383a is the less saturated color, while #18036f is the most saturated one.
